The Operations Manager plays a key role in keeping our day-to-day operations running smoothly in support of our NETA electrical testing services. This person is responsible for making sure projects are properly staffed, planned, equipped, and executed safely and efficiently. You'll work closely with technicians, customers, and internal teams to ensure testing projects are completed on time, meet NETA standards, and deliver a high level of quality and professionalism.

This role is focused on coordinating people, schedules, equipment, and processes to support successful project execution from kickoff through closeout.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Oversee daily operations supporting NETA electrical testing services, ensuring work is executed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with applicable testing standards.
  • Help create structure and consistency by implementing clear processes, accountability, and operational discipline.
  • Monitor job progress, technician availability, and customer commitments to ensure testing projects stay on track.
  • Identify operational bottlenecks and implement improvements to increase efficiency, quality, and overall performance.
  • Schedule and assign technicians to testing projects based on scope, timing, location, and technician qualifications.
  • Balance technician workloads while maintaining flexibility to respond to urgent or unplanned testing needs.
  • Coordinate travel, overtime, and coverage plans to support project schedules and customer deadlines.
  • Develop, review, or coordinate testing plans to ensure alignment with project scope, standards, and customer expectations.
  • Ensure work packages are complete prior to mobilization, including scope clarity, equipment readiness, safety requirements, site coordination, and scheduling.
  • Confirm the team has the technical capability, certifications, and resources needed to perform electrical testing safely and to standard.
  • Create and manage change orders when project scope, site conditions, or customer requirements evolve.
  • Communicate scope or schedule changes internally and with customers to ensure proper approvals and documentation.
  • Keep schedules, staffing plans, and deliverables aligned with confirmed scope changes.
  • Ensure testing equipment and tools are available, properly maintained, and ready to support current and upcoming testing work.
  • Coordinate equipment tracking, availability, maintenance, and calibration as required for testing accuracy and compliance.
  • Identify equipment needs early and help plan for rentals or purchases to avoid delays.
  • Support technician development through training, mentorship, performance feedback, and career progression.
  • Assist with hiring and onboarding technicians with the skills and aptitude to support electrical testing services.
  • Oversee preparation and review of customer test reports to ensure accuracy, completeness, and professional presentation.
  • Ensure reports meet applicable standards and are delivered to customers in a timely manner.
  • Coordinate report completion from field documentation through final delivery, resolving any missing information or technical questions.
  • Serve as an internal escalation point for active projects and help resolve operational, scheduling, or technical challenges.
  • Communicate professionally with customers regarding schedules, project updates, and deliverables.
  • Partner with sales and estimating teams to ensure testing work is properly scoped and operationally supported.
  • Track key operational metrics such as technician utilization, project timelines, and report turnaround times.
  • Provide leadership with regular updates on operational performance, risks, and improvement opportunities.
  • Help strengthen operational systems, processes, and workflows to improve efficiency, consistency, and service quality.
Required Qualifications
  • 5+ years of operations management experience in a field service environment (electrical, power systems, industrial services, or similar preferred)
  • Experience scheduling and managing field personnel across multiple projects
  • Strong leadership skills and experience supporting technician development
  • Highly organized with strong attention to detail, especially around documentation and reporting
  • Comfortable using Microsoft 365 and scheduling or job tracking systems
  • Valid driver’s license
Preferred Qualifications
  • Familiarity with electrical testing standards and testing plans
  • Current NETA certification
  • Experience working in critical environments such as utilities, industrial facilities, or data centers
  • Experience improving workflows, processes, or operational systems
